Elizabeth Wertenberger Biography

Elizabeth Ann Wertenberger is an American beauty pageant titleholder from Dundee, Michigan who was named Miss Michigan 2011.

Biography

She won the title of Miss Michigan on June 18, 2011, when she received her crown from outgoing titleholder Katie LaRoche. Wertenberger's platform is "Continue to Dream: Giving Hope to Children with Chronic Illnesses". Wertenberger graduated from Ferris State University's Kendall College of Art and Design in May 2011 with a Bachelors of Arts degree in Interior Design and a minor in Graphic Design. At 13, Wertenberger was diagnosed with juvenile rheumatoid arthritis, and had to undergo chemotherapy. She was named a Quality of Life Finalist at the Miss America 2012 pageant.
